In this review of The Implications of Induction, the reviewer finds a careful, philosophically rigorous treatment best suited to readers with serious interest in the logic of scientific reasoning. Originally published in 1973, L. Jonathan Cohen sets out an alternative to mathematical probability and offers a structured account of inductive support for hypotheses; the single biggest reason to buy is the book's methodical criteria of adequacy and the final system of logical syntax, which make it valuable as a reference for scholars and advanced students studying inductive logic.
Key Features
- Alternative to probability: Presents a valid mode of reasoning that differs from mathematical probability and explains its implications for scientific inquiry.
- Criteria of adequacy: Lays out and examines clear criteria for assessing inductive support, helping readers evaluate hypotheses more systematically.
- Philosophical depth: Discusses paradoxes and philosophical problems about experimental support, giving historical and conceptual context.
- Logical syntax: Concludes with a coherent system of logical syntax for induction, useful as a technical toolbox for formal analysis.
- Reader aids: Each section opens with a summary and the book includes a glossary of technical terms to assist comprehension.
Who It's For
The Implications of Induction is primarily for philosophers of science, advanced students in logic, and researchers who want a methodical alternative to probability-based accounts of support. Its emphasis on criteria and formal syntax makes it suitable as a secondary text in graduate seminars or as a reference for writing on inference and justification.
Those seeking an introductory or casually readable overview of probability should look elsewhere; the book assumes some prior familiarity with philosophical issues and technical vocabulary, even though the glossary and summaries ease navigation.
